WebTry this test: Standing tall with your crutches at you side, allow your hand to drape over the grip. The deep crease between the palm of your hand and your wrist should line up with the top surface of your grip. If that crease falls above the top of the grip, there is a good chance your crutches are too short. WebSqueeze the crutches between your upper arm and ribs. Take the weight through your hands. Move the crutches forward, then move your sore leg forward. Put your foot even with the crutches. Put as much weight as you are allowed on the sore leg, taking the rest of the weight through your arms and hands press hard on the hand grips.

WebFit the crutch in your arm and put it on ground. Now adjust the height of the forearm crutch so that the handgrip comes at the level of your hip. Your forearm should be almost fully flexed while holding the crutch. While adjusting the forearm crutch height, make sure you do not set the height too long.
